
NFL Teams Drop Eagles' Quarterback Sneak Ban, Eye A.J. Brown Trade
About this episode
NFL insider Mike Florio highlights the sudden shift in perspective on the Philadelphia Eagles signature quarterback sneak, tush push, following their early playoff exit. Meanwhile, rumors swirl about a potential trade of wide receiver A.J. Brown to avoid salary cap issues, with the New England Patriots reportedly interested.

On March 25, NFL insider Mike Floreo recently called out teams pushing to ban the Philadelphia Eagles Signature Quarterback Sneak, known as the Tush Push. Last year, squads like the Green Bay Packers wanted it gone ahead of the 2025 league meetings, claiming it was unsafe or unfootball-like. But now, with the Eagles out early in the playoffs, that talk has vanished. Floreo points out how quickly priorities shift when a team loses its edge on the play. Team saw it as unbeatable when Philly dominated, but after the wildcard exit and no Super Bowl run, it's no longer a hot issue for 2026. Rules changes. Shifting gears, Floreo also dropped word from a salary cap expert urging the Eagles to trade wide receiver AJ. Brown before next year to dodge Cap Chaos. Pete Buzz suggests a deal could hit after June 2nd, with the New England Patriots as top suitors, though signing Brown's buddy Elijah Moore might. Stir things up. For now, Philly's roster moves remain front and center, as free agency heats up.
